Instructions
Paint the backside of the paper plate black and let dry.
Turn the plate over to the unpainted side. Cut out the body using the pattern. Cut out the tail and head from the remaining plate. Set scraps aside.
Use tape to attach the tail and the head to the back of the plate, using the photo as a guide.
Glue on wiggle eyes and pink pom-pom for the nose.
From the scraps of black plate, cut 6 thin whiskers of equal length and glue to the cat’s face.
